J. Purdey & Sons Side by Side Back Action Double Rifle in 450 Nitro Express (3 1/4 Inch) with Case

Introduced in 1898, the 450 Nitro Express was an evolution of the black powder 450 Express round, and became one of the chief rounds for hunting dangerous game in Africa and India. Beaded blade front sight and four leaf platinum wire accented rear sight, graduated for 100, 150, 200 and 250 yards, with matte serrations on the front and rear sections of the rib and the smooth mid-section marked "J.PURDEY, 314 1/2 OXFORD STREET, LONDON.". The sleeved barrels are a fine blue finished Damascus twist, with London proofs and "C.A" on the water table and a single piece extractor. The frame, locks, hammers and break lever/trigger guard are all casehardened and decorated with scroll and floral engraving, with the coverage on the upper tang reaching nearly 100%. Each lock is marked "PURDEY" in small, fine letters and outfitted with a niter blue finished sliding half-cock safety, and the combination trigger guard, side-turning break lever and checkered hand rest also doubling as a trigger-locking safety; when opened, a spring loaded button on the lower tang slides into the safe position, and is automatically depressed into the fire position when closed. A semi-circular projection extends asymmetrically from the right side of the lower tang to prevent the stock from being scratched by the underside of the lever. Checkered straight wrist stock, with scroll and floral engraved hardware on the splinter forearm, sling eyes, a thin shadow line cheekpiece, silver inscription panel with a crowned "MAC" monogram, and a floral engraved and checkered steel buttplate marked "CHARGE/3 1/4 dms No. 6 Powder" near the heel. With a brass handled hardwood locking case, with a Purdey label on the red felt interior, with eleven spent 450 Nitro cases. The "MAC" monogram has not been positively identified, though the design of the crown is a close match for the traditional heraldic crown of European princes (particularly of the Holy Roman Empire, the Austrian Empire, Liechtenstein, and Imperial Russia), suggesting acquisition by a member of a family in high standing. Length of pull is 13 7/8 inches, drop at comb is 1 3/16 inches, drop at heel is 2 5/8 inches.

Very fine as period refurbished. The barrels show 85% of the deep blue finish, with a few hints of gray, light handling marks, and a strong Damascus pattern to the barrels. Bright and vivid case colors are present on the frame and locks, with a silver patina showing on the backs of the locks, the underside of the lever and on the side extension to the lower tang. Strong niter blue is present on the safeties. The stock is very good, with some light pressure dents, sharp checkering, and attractive grain. The case is fair, with a few scuffs on the lining and label, small sections of absent wood in the interior, and mild scratches and scuffs overall. Mechanically excellent.
